I'm an alum and former RC (also OOS and went OR) so here's my advice: 1) Go where you feel most comfortable. If you can be yourself and feel accepted then friendships will follow. DON'T pledge a house that makes you feel like you always have to be "your best" or "perfect" in order to belong... because once you join, your sisters will see you at your best and worst. 2) Pay attention to how women treat each other during pref. This tells you a lot more about the culture of a house than how they treat PNMs. 3) Look past the stereotype and remember that there are dozens of OOS (even far OOS) girls in EVERY sorority, including old row, and that becomes the case more and more as time goes on. You will be just fine no matter where you end up :)
